CVE-2023-27312 | Privilege Escalation Vulnerability in SnapCenter Plugin for VMware vSphere
SnapCenter Plugin for VMware vSphere versions 4.6 prior to 4.9 are
susceptible to a vulnerability which may allow authenticated
unprivileged users to modify email and snapshot name settings within the
VMware vSphere user interface.
Conclusion & alert: CVE-2023-27312 is rated Low Risk (33/100): CVSS Medium severity, with low exploitation likelihood (EPSS 0.13%).Mandatory action: Monitor for updates and reassess as exploit intelligence or EPSS changes.
